This 4-star hotel is in the historic Storchenturm Tower in the heart of Eisenach, just 300 ft from the Market Square. It offers rooms with satellite TV.
Regional specialties and a daily breakfast buffet can be enjoyed at Restaurant Wintergarten, which features a beer garden. The Schiffchen cocktail bar serves a range of drinks, and the Dirty Dancing bar is open on weekends.
Warm colors and traditional wood décor can be found in the Hotel Eisenacher Hof's romantic rooms. Each has a desk, minibar and private bathroom.
The hotel is a convenient base for exploring Eisenach's cultural attractions such as the Bach House, St George's Church and the Luther House, all within a 15 minute walk of the hotel. Parking spaces can be found nearby.
